about

StilrizE's debut album from 2006. This being the album that started the buzz, and following for the band all around the New England area, myspace, etc.

credits

released November 1, 2006

Lyrics written by Andrew Deprey
Music written by Sean Timmins, Dan Timmins, Mike Ciardi, and Andrew Deprey
Recorded, Mixed, and Mastered by Alex Hatziyannis
Produced by StilrizE and Alex Hatziyannis
Album Artwork by Rosie Byron
Other artwork by Steve Braga, and "Irish"
Management by Travis Deprey, and Steve Braga (T&S Management)
